    About

    Yacine Adli is a French professional footballer who plays as a midfielder for Al Shabab in the Saudi Pro League. Known for his technical skill, vision, and composure on the ball, he has built a reputation as a creative playmaker capable of dictating the tempo of a match.

    Adli came through the youth system at Paris Saint-Germain and made his professional debut for the club in 2018. After a breakthrough spell at Bordeaux, he moved to AC Milan, where he won the Serie A title in his first season. In September 2025, he signed for Al Shabab, marking a new chapter in his career.

    With over 200 senior appearances across Europe's top leagues, Adli remains a player of considerable promise. His ability to retain possession and pick out incisive passes has earned him admiration from coaches and fans alike.

    Early Life & Background

    Born in Vitry-sur-Seine, a suburb southeast of Paris, Yacine Adli grew up in a family with Algerian heritage. From an early age, football was his focus, and his talent quickly became apparent on the local pitches. He joined the youth setup at Paris Saint-Germain, where he trained in the club's renowned academy alongside some of the best young players in France.

    Adli's technical ability and football intelligence set him apart. He was particularly noted for his close control, vision, and ability to distribute the ball with precision. In 2018, he made his professional debut for PSG in the Coupe de la Ligue against Bastia, becoming the youngest player to appear for the club in that competition. He also featured in the UEFA Champions League that season, a remarkable achievement for a teenager.

    Despite his early promise, first-team opportunities at PSG were limited. In 2019, he made the decision to move to Bordeaux, seeking regular playing time to continue his development. It was a pivotal step that shaped the rest of his career.

    Career Growth

    Yacine Adli's move to Bordeaux in 2019 proved transformative. Over two seasons, he made more than 100 appearances for the club, establishing himself as one of Ligue 1's most promising young midfielders. His performances attracted interest from top European clubs, and in August 2021 he signed for AC Milan.

    In his first season at Milan, Adli was part of the squad that won the Serie A title, a significant milestone in his career. However, consistent playing time proved elusive, and he spent the 2023–24 campaign on loan at Fiorentina, where he gained valuable experience in a different tactical system.

    In September 2025, Adli made a permanent move to Al Shabab in the Saudi Pro League. The transfer was reported to include a significant salary increase, reportedly around €7 million net annually. Since joining, he has adapted to the physical demands of the Saudi league and continues to feature regularly for the club.

    Interesting Facts and Legends

    Yacine Adli is one of the few players to have represented both Paris Saint-Germain and AC Milan, two clubs with a fierce rivalry in European competition. He is known for his humility, often deflecting praise toward his teammates in interviews. Off the pitch, Adli keeps a relatively low profile. He has a significant social media following, with over 391,000 followers on Instagram, where he shares match highlights and training content. He is also active on Twitter/X and Snapchat. Adli's preferred foot is his right, and he is comfortable playing as a defensive or central midfielder. His passing range and ability to control the tempo of a game are among his standout attributes. A notable chapter in his career occurred when he officially moved from AC Milan to the Saudi Pro League club Al-Shabab. Following this transfer, Adli publicly stated that he had absolutely wanted to stay at Milan, attributing his departure solely to the club's decision. Reports indicated the exit involved a fee of approximately €8 million for Milan and a contract worth €7 million net for Adli. Additionally, it is noted that Adli has snubbed the Algerian national team, known as the Fennecs, on multiple occasions despite holding Algerian citizenship alongside his French nationality. He previously represented France at the U20 level before focusing entirely on his club career.
